Why Subscription Business Beats Every Other Model

Compare the subscription model to alternatives. A freelancer doing project work earns money this month but starts from zero next month. An e-commerce store owner sells products but faces constant margin pressure and inventory risk. An affiliate marketer earns when someone clicks a link and buys - unpredictable, inconsistent, and dependent on factors outside their control. A subscription business owner with thirty clients starts every single month having already earned their base income before they do anything. Additional activity adds to this base. A bad month does not wipe out progress. The financial foundation is stable in a way that other self-employment models simply are not.

What Makes an AI Subscription So Sticky

The retention rate for AI phone answering and chatbot services is very high, and for good reason. Once a business has integrated the AI into how they handle customers, removing it feels like going backwards. The owner has stopped worrying about missed calls. Their booking rate has improved. Their evenings are less interrupted by calls they cannot take. To cancel means returning to the old problem - and the old problem now feels intolerable because they have experienced the alternative. This is what makes the AI subscription a fundamentally different client relationship than most services: the value is experienced every day, not just at renewal time.
